Summary

In the spirit of Halloween, Radio Free Mormon today sheds light on Joseph Smith’s treasure Digging by setting the details of Joseph Smith’s Treasure Digging next to the eerie Treasure Digging of John Steinbeck’s Tortilla Flat. RFM takes on the dramatized telling of this John Steinbeck classic.
